Making crispy, crusty, golden loaves of bread at home has never been easier. It all starts with bread baking in a Dutch oven (lidded pot), the perfect vessel for making artisan-style loaves. The steam that’s created inside the pot miraculously transforms the dough, ensuring the bread’s crust will shatter into delicate shards with each bite. The best way to produce steam inside a lidded pot? It’s simple: preheat the pot. Gently slipping risen yeast dough into a searing hot pot and adding the lid creates steam. In turn, this results in bread with a crackly crust and a glossy surface that’s beautifully blistered with bubbles.

You can store freshly created royal icing made with meringue powder in an airtight container at room temperature for up to 2 weeks. Before using it on another dessert, all you need to do is beat it well in a mixing bowl at low speed. Now if you don’t have plans to use the icing within 2 weeks, another option is to pipe out your decorations and let them harden. Hardened royal icing decorations can be placed in an airtight container in a dry, dark place to prevent fading for up to 6 months or stored in a covered, NON-airtight container (like a cake box) for years! They’re great to have on hand for future bakes that need some decoration. You should NEVER store royal icing decorations in the freezer. The Discovery of Chocolate (1500s and earlier) Before it became the creamy dessert we know today, chocolate began as a sacred plant hidden deep in the rainforests of Mesoamerica, now known as present-day Mexico. Over 4,000 years ago, the Olmecs were among the first to discover cacao beans, where they crushed the cacao pods and used them in ritual, ceremonial or medicinal drinks. Fast forward a few centuries and the Mayans fully adopted and embraced the cacao culture. They didn’t just enjoy cacao like the Olmecs, the Mayans worshipped it as one of their gods. Cacao beans were so prized, they were used in religious rituals, traded as currency, and even buried with the dead to accompany them to the afterlife. Drinking their chocolate (which was still far from the sweet version we know) was a symbol of status, power, and divine favour. The “Xicolatl” Drink Imagine a foamy, bitter, spiced chocolate mixture instead of your usual hot cocoa. That’s what was known as, “Xocolatl,” the early versions of a chocolate drink from the Aztecs. Made by grinding roasted cacao beans with chilli, cornmeal and water… This thick beverage surely packed a flavourful punch. When Spanish explorers set foot in the Americas in the early 1500s, they brought back cacao beans to Europe, where it caused quite a stir amongst the aristocracy. But to European palates, the bitter brew from the Aztecs was too intense, so they got creative. By adding cane sugar, honey, vanilla, and even cinnamon, this new, European mixture was a sweeter, silkier and smoother version of the Aztecs’ “Xocolatl” drink. It wasn’t long before it gained popularity in royal courts and high society circles, a luxury only the rich could enjoy. Hailed not only for its health benefits but for its high status and exclusivity. The Development of Chocolate Till Today Until the 19th century, chocolate was mostly something you drank… But in 1847, British company J.S. Fry & Sons mixed cocoa butter, cocoa powder, and sugar to create a firm, mouldable version: the first chocolate bar! Safe to say that over time, many Swiss chocolatiers perfected chocolate to be finer, smoother and glossier. This era gave rise to giant chocolate companies and transformed chocolate from a sacred drink to snackable delights. Today, chocolate comes in many forms and even flavours: there’s Dark Chocolate for the bold, Milk Chocolate for the nostalgic and White Chocolate for the sweet-toothed. Different types of cookware have different lifespans. While there is no exact timeframe of when you should replace your cookware, most nonstick cookware items will remain good for about five years. This being so, you can do things to ensure that your pots and pans remain in good shape for as long as possible.Tips to Maintain Your Cookware To guarantee that your cookware is adequately cared for and improve your skills in the kitchen, follow these simple tips:Stick to Hand WashingBecause of the heat and pressure applied in a dishwasher, placing your pots and pans in one can be pretty damaging. To increase the lifespan of your cookware, be sure to hand wash them with dish soap and water.If you run into a few baked-on stains that won’t come off with a typical scrub, add baking soda to your pans while washing them. Doing so will help lift the stains off the surface and add strength to your scrubbing. To keep your pots and pans coating from coming off, use an ordinary kitchen sponge and stay away from metallic brushes.Oil Your Pans WellWhen cooking anything in your pots and pans, be sure to prepare them first with a bit of oil. Adding olive oil, coconut oil, or butter will help create a non-stick surface and prevent food from adhering to the pan. Not only does this protect your cookware, but it also results in a much easier cleanup.Use a Soft SpatulaWhen handling food in your pans, be sure to use a spatula made of a soft material like wood, silicone, or food-grade plastic. This will protect the non-stick coating of your cookware and ensure that they are not damaged in the process.Refrain from Using Cooking SpraysCooking spray often contains chemicals, and these chemicals are not suitable for you or your baking tools. To prevent the nonstick coating on your pans from damage, refrain from using cooking sprays and use oil instead.Different Types of Cookware Nonstick PansDifferent types of nonstick frying pans are extremely popular and have made cooking (and cleaning) in the kitchen an easy task! Nonstick pans are a type of cookware that has a special nonstick coating. This coating allows food to cook in the pan without actually sticking to it. The coating of most nonstick cookware is made of polytetrafluoroethylene, also known as Teflon.When well taken care of, most nonstick pans will last up to 5 years. So, how do you know if it’s time to replace your nonstick cookware? It’s advisable to replace your pans once you notice that the surface has begun to peel. If the surface is peeling, the coating underneath could mix with the food cooked on it and become a health hazard.Ceramic CookwareIn comparison to nonstick pans, ceramic cookware is pricier but more efficient. Ceramic cookware requires less grease and is free of many chemicals and substances that nonstick cookware contains.This being so, the typical lifespan of ceramic cookware is much shorter than nonstick cookware. Ceramic pans have a lifespan of just about a year. However, that year can be extended to nearly three years when well taken care of.More and more at-home chefs are deciding to switch to ceramic cookware because the ceramic coating is free of PTFE and PFOA, two harmful chemicals often found in nonstick coatings. Most ceramic pans are also non-stick and easy to clean.When used frequently, ceramic cookware will begin to chip and these ceramic bits can mix with your food. If you notice your ceramic pan chipping, it’s time to replace them. Like traditional pots and pans, to extend the life of your ceramics and keep them in good condition, handwashing is recommended.Stainless Steel CookwareA stainless steel pan is non-coated and commonly made out of stainless steel. Their lack of coating allows food to brown better and makes them a little more durable than most nonstick pans. Because you don’t have to worry about protecting a coating, stainless steel pans are usually oven safe and can be cleaned without fear of damaging the pan itself.This being so, their lack of a nonstick surface can make burnt-on food challenging to remove and may require a bit of extra scrubbing. Because of stainless steel pans’ durability, they frequently last significantly longer than nonstick and ceramic pans. When well taken care of, stainless steel pans can endure for decades!Iron SkilletsKnowing how to use a cast iron skillet and properly caring for it will make it last for a very long time. You may even have a skillet that has been passed down in your family over the years. Because cast iron skillets don’t have any kind of coating on them, you won’t have to worry about it wearing down over time.The one thing you do want to look out for when cooking with cast iron cookware is bacteria. Each time you clean your skillet, be sure to clean it well. Due to their lack of coating, food tends to accumulate on the surface of cast iron skillets, and too much food growth over time can cause bacteria to form.When Should You Buy a New Set of Cookware? Regardless of which kind of pots and pans you purchase, there are several telltale signs that it’s time to swap them out for a newer version. Here are a few of the most common:Your Cookware Is WarpedIf your cookware has become warped, it’s likely time for a new set. Warped cookware is when your pan becomes bent out of shape. The most common cause of warped cookware is when a pan is heated or cooled too quickly, causing certain parts of the pan to expand and tighten faster than others.While warped cookware isn’t generally a health hazard, it will affect your pots and pans’ cooking quality and distribute heat unevenly. How can you tell if your pan is warped? If you can’t tell just by looking at it, try placing your pan on a flat surface and see if it wiggles. If it does, the heat won’t be distributed evenly, resulting in certain areas being over or undercooked.Your Stainless Steel Cookware Is ChippingIf you know how to clean stainless steel pots and care for them properly, stainless steel pots and pans can last for a long time. However, if you notice that the stainless steel exterior on your pans has begun to chip, it’s time to invest in a new one. You’ll want to replace your pots and pans upon the first sight of chipping to ensure that bits of stainless steel don’t break off into your food.How can you tell if the stainless steel is wearing off? Take a look at the base of your pot; if it’s a different color, then the stainless steel coating has started to wear down.The Cookware Handles Are in Bad ShapeTaking proper care of cookware extends far beyond the actual pot and pan. You’ll want to pay attention to the handles as well. Not all cookware is equipped with heat-safe handles, and because of this, the amount of heat they encounter needs to be monitored. If your pan’s handle is introduced to too much heat at once, it may melt or fall off while you’re cooking.Additionally, over time handles can wear to the point where there is a chance they may break when using them. If you notice your cookware’s handle is about to fall off, then it’s time to replace it. If new pots and pans aren’t in your budget at the moment, we recommend removing the handle altogether rather than continuing to cook with it. A faulty handle may expose your food and your hands to high levels of heat that put you at risk of getting burned.If you’re working with a pot or pan without the handle, be sure to use an oven mitt to protect your hands from high temperatures.Overall, taking proper care of your cookware will drastically affect how long it lasts. This is also true of the quality. Purchasing high-quality cookware will help your pots and pain remain intact, even when used frequently.Pots and pans of a lower quality are generally made with materials that warp, chip and melt easier. What Is Baking Soda?Baking soda, also known as sodium bicarbonate, is a naturally occurring crystalline chemical compound but is often found in powder form. Although baking soda is naturally occurring, it is often mined and, through a chemical process, created. Most baking sodas found commercially in the United States come from ore mined in Wyoming. The ore is heated until it turns to soda ash, and then it is combined with carbon dioxide to create the chemical baking soda. That being said, naturally occurring baking soda is also still available and is mined in the form of nahcolite. Nahcolite is the form of sodium bicarbonate that is most natural and has no chemical additives. Bob’s Red Mill is proud to sell natural baking soda that has not been chemically produced.Baking soda is highly versatile and when used by itself or combined with additional compounds, can lend itself as a remedy for multiple different uses. Valued for its cleaning and baking properties, baking soda has been used for thousands of years. Use of baking soda dates back to Ancient Egypt when it was used as a cleaning and drying agent in the process of mummification. Baking soda became commercially available during the mid-19th century and has since become a staple in most homes, whether it’s in cleaning products, beauty products, or even in a wide range of cooking and baking recipes.How Does Baking Soda Work?Baking soda is most commonly used in baking as a leavening agent, hence its name. Before the commercialization of baking soda, biological leavening and fermentation processes were used but less convenient due to the extensive length of time associated with biological leavening. As most have formerly learned through science class and experimental measures, when a base meets an acidic ingredient like buttermilk, sour cream or lemon juice, a chemical reaction occurs. This concept is the same for baking soda as it pertains to baking. When baking soda is mixed with an acid and a liquid, it will create bubbles of carbon dioxide gas that give it a fluffy texture. That being said, baking soda can react without acid if it is warmed above 122°F or subject to long-term heat and humidity. If baking soda is stored within reasonable temperatures (at or below 77°F and 75% humidity), it will keep indefinitely.Baking soda is generally used as an active ingredient in quick-bake recipes such as cookies, muffins, and pancakes. This is because of the fast-acting chemical reaction associated with baking soda and the acidic counterpart. When baking soda is combined with acid, CO2 gas bubbles are released, creating the “airy” effect in batter and dough. Furthermore, once the dough or batter starts to bake, the carbon dioxide will begin to filter through the dough and expand air that is trapped inside. The sources of acid combined with the baking soda will determine if the dough or batter can be kept in the refrigerator or needs to be baked immediately.For example, if the sources of acid are dry, such as cream of tartar or cocoa powder, then they can keep longer once combined with baking soda. However, if the acids are wet, such as yogurt or lemon juice, then the resulting batter will need to be used promptly. Baking soda can also provide dough with increased pH levels, which creates a heightened alkalinity. Through the increase in pH, the gluten in the dough becomes weakened, which creates a tender texture for cookies and pastries versus something chewier such as bread. Quantity is an important component, considering the effect baking soda has on baking recipes. Baking Soda for Household UseBaking soda is a versatile product that has many household uses simply by itself or when combined with other products. Due to its coarse salt-like nature, baking soda can be used as a scrub of sorts for fruits and vegetables, grills, countertops and even teeth. Commonly added to many kinds of toothpaste, baking soda is a natural powerhouse cleaning product. Baking soda is widely used as a refrigerator deodorant of sorts because some believe it neutralizes lingering odor. Chemically, baking soda reacts in a similar fashion when it is used in baking recipes such as muffins and scones as it does with odors. This is because baking soda is basic and most odors are acidic, and this provides for a similar atmosphere for a neutralizing reaction to occur.Baking soda and vinegar are not only baking partners in crime, but also stellar cleaning partners, due to their chemical composition. When combined in baking recipes, baking soda and vinegar (or acid) work together harmoniously to create the leavening process of batters and doughs. Similarly, when combined for cleaning purposes, baking soda and vinegar create an abrasive environment that is tough on stains, dirt, and clogged drains. As previously mentioned, when baking soda is heated above 122°F, it creates carbon dioxide. This is what makes baking soda a great fire extinguisher and why it remains one of best ways to put out a grease fire. The increase of carbon dioxide cuts off the fire’s source of oxygen, creating an environment that is not sustainable for the fire.Baking Soda vs. Baking PowderSimilar to baking soda, baking powder is a leavening agent used in quick-bake recipes. Often confused and mistaken for one another, these two interact within recipes in different ways and are very different in composition. It is important to consider the differences between both baking soda and baking powder when exploring baking recipes. As previously mentioned, baking soda is a leavening agent that, when mixed with acid and liquid, becomes activated and produces CO2 bubbles. Similarly, baking powder is a leavening agent that produces CO2 bubbles. However, the composition is one of the major differences.Baking powder is composed of baking soda itself, paired with another dry acid, such as cream of tartar. As a result, baking powder has the ability to be single or double acting. Single-acting baking powder performs in a similar way to baking soda that has been combined with an acid. It quickly releases CO2 and creates the leavening process that must be quickly taken advantage of. However, a double-acting baking powder can be activated twice through different means. Once the liquid is added to the baking powder, it becomes activated and produces the CO2 bubbles.In addition to the first activation, there is a secondary activation that can take place once the solution, or batter, is exposed to heat (placed in the oven). This also creates the ability for an elongated time frame that is not present within the reaction caused with baking soda and acid. This means that because baking powder is activated by liquid and already has the dry acid component (cream of tartar), it can be preserved in the refrigerator longer. This is why items such as cookie dough can remain in the refrigerator, while cake batter must be cooked promptly.Why Is Baking Soda Important?Baking soda is an important and fundamental component of most baked goods and many cleaning products for several reasons. It is the driving force behind the desired consistency and taste of most of our quick-bake treats, and the powerhouse cleaning agent in many of our household products. Through the chemical reaction created by combining baking soda with liquid, acid, and heat, carbon dioxide is created. These tiny CO2 gas bubbles allow for soft and airy baked goods such as cookies, pancakes, and cakes. Baking soda also increases pH levels while reducing gluten. This creates less chewy and more tender baked goods. Though baking soda recipes call for seemingly small amounts, it makes all the difference if you don’t have it. To help you better determine which plant milk is suitable for your diet, we’ve created this guide covering the basics of soy milk vs. almond milk protein and its benefits.What Is Soy Milk?Soy milk is plant milk made from soybeans. It’s a popular alternative to dairy milk made by soaking and grinding soybeans. Soy milk is available at most grocery stores in sweetened and unsweetened varieties. It is often fortified with vitamins and minerals like calcium and vitamin D. Soy milk can also be made at home and enjoyed as a beverage.Soy Milk NutritionThere are several types of soy milk available for purchase, and the nutritional facts will vary depending on the one you buy. Many kinds of soy milk contain added sugar and flavorings, creating plant milk that’s high in calories. For the most nutritious soy milk, search for one that uses minimal ingredients and sweeteners. Natural soy milk tends to be relatively healthy and acts as a source of protein and fiber. What Is Almond Milk?Almond milk is a nut-based milk alternative that’s quickly growing in popularity. Its light flavor makes it a favorite amongst dairy-free individuals. Almond milk is made by soaking, grinding and straining raw almonds into a milk-like liquid. It is an excellent alternative to dairy milk and can be used in various recipes.Almond Milk Nutrition Though almond milk is nutritious on its own, manufacturers usually fortify it with additional vitamins and minerals like calcium, riboflavin, vitamin D and vitamin E to create a more rich nutritional content. Soy Milk ProteinSoy milk is a source of plant-based protein, making it an excellent milk alternative for vegans and vegetarians looking to incorporate more of this nutrient into their diet. While many plant proteins lack the essential amino acids to be a complete protein, soy milk contains all nine essential amino acids required. Your body uses these amino acids to create new proteins, which help boost immune system function, produce energy, facilitate nutrient absorption and aid in tissue repair.How Does Soy Protein Compare to Meat?Soy protein is a high-quality protein. Compared to meat, soy contains comparable amounts of protein, fiber, vitamins and minerals without the extra cholesterol and saturated fat typically found in meat.Almond Milk Protein Almonds, in their complete form, are often labeled a superfood. This is because they contain vitamins, protein and other nutrients vital to good health. However, that doesn’t mean that a glass of almond milk has the same nutritional benefits. For example, while almonds are naturally high in protein, the protein found in almond milk isn’t comparable to the protein in dairy milk. In addition, unlike dairy milk, almond milk is mostly water. This high percentage of water means that it contains a small percentage of almonds and their nutrients.How Does Almond Milk Protein Compare to Soy Milk?Compared to soy milk protein, almond milk is not a complete source of protein. Because it does not contain all nine essential amino acids, other foods are needed to complete the protein source and provide you with the health benefits.Benefits and Disadvantages of Soy Milk vs. Almond MilkBenefits of Soy MilkAside from being a source of high-quality protein, soy milk also offers many other health benefits.Soy Milk Is a Source of Vitamins and MineralsSoy milk is full of beneficial nutrients. Vitamins and minerals are an essential part of a healthy diet, and soy milk contains many. In addition, drinking soy milk can increase your intake of essential nutrients like calcium and iron, which work to keep your bones, blood vessels and tissue healthy and strong. Whether you drink soy milk straight from the glass or use it in baked good recipes, it is an excellent boost of nutrition.Soy Milk Is VeganSoy milk is an excellent milk alternative for individuals who avoid dairy products. Aside from being a high-quality plant based protein source, soy milk is incredibly versatile. Its mild flavor and milk-like texture make it easy to recreate your favorite recipes sans animal products. You may notice slight flavor differences when first drinking soy milk. However, most people adjust to the taste of it quickly.Soybeans Contain AntioxidantsSoybeans contain potent antioxidants that work hard to protect your cells from damage known as oxidative stress. When molecules called free radicals cause damage to your cells, it results in oxidative stress, which is attributed to aging, illness and disease. So consuming antioxidant-rich foods like soybeans help better protect your cells to keep you healthy and youthful.Disadvantages of Soy Milk Soy Milk Is a High-Allergen FoodWhile soy milk is an excellent dairy alternative, it’s not for everyone. Individuals with soy allergies should avoid soy milk and consume other plant based milk alternatives like almond milk. Additionally, people with a soy allergy will need to check food labels frequently as soy milk is in many processed foods.Soy Milk Can Be High in SugarWhen purchasing pre-made soy milk, check the label for processed sugars and additives. Flavored and sweetened soy milk can quickly boost calorie intake without offering extra nutritional value. We recommend choosing an unsweetened, unflavored and minimally processed variety for the best quality soy milk.Benefits of Almond MilkWhile almond milk is not a source of high-quality protein, it does offer up some pretty impressive benefits. Here are a few of the most noteworthy.Almond Milk Is Low in CarbsUnsweetened almond milk is naturally low in carbs, making it an excellent option for individuals following a low-carb diet like the ketogenic one. Additionally, the small amount of carbs that almond milk does contain is primarily dietary fiber, which is crucial to good gut health. When searching for low-carb options for almond milk, stick to unsweetened varieties that don’t contain additives, artificial flavors, or sugars.Almond Milk Is VeganLike soy milk, almond milk is a vegan alternative to cow’s milk. It’s made from almonds and water and is an excellent option for people who need to limit dairy, no matter the reason. Almond milk can be enjoyed as a drink, combined with cereal, or used to create delicious baked goods. Great-tasting and versatile, the possibilities are endless.Almond Milk Is Widely AvailableAlmond milk is a popular plant based drink found in most grocery stores. Its widely available nature and pleasant flavor make it easy for those with dairy, soy and lactose allergies to enjoy. Additionally, almond milk is easy to make and can be made at home with just a few ingredients.Disadvantages of Almond Milk Almond Milk is Not Safe for Individuals with Tree Nut AllergiesWhile almond milk is lactose free, dairy free, gluten free and vegan, that doesn’t mean that it is an appropriate and safe milk alternative for everyone. For example, individuals with a tree nut allergy should not consume almond milk, as they can suffer from a severe allergic reaction. Instead, we recommend choosing different plant based milk such as soy, oat or hemp milk.It’s Not a Great Source of ProteinThough almond milk does have some protein, it’s not a good source. Almond milk contains more water than it does almonds, meaning that many of almonds’ nutrients are not as concentrated as they would be if you ate the almonds whole. While almond milk is a good alternative to dairy-based milk, it’s not the best option for those looking to add more protein to their diet.If you’re looking for an alternative to cow’s milk, almond milk and soy milk are excellent places to start. Both unique in their ways, soy milk provides high-quality protein and nutrients and is ideal for individuals looking to boost the nutritional value of their meals. In comparison, almond milk offers a low-calorie and low-carb alternative, beneficial for those who follow low-carb diets like the ketogenic diet. Let’s get baking.If you want to make your own sourdough starter from scratchTo make your own sourdough starter, you only need three things: flour, water, and time. You’ll start by combining equal parts flour and water. Let that mixture rest at room temperature, and then regularly discard some of it and refresh with more flour and water. As the mixture sits over the course of several days, it will begin to cultivate a flourishing community of microorganisms (which is what makes your bread rise) and slowly become bubbly and vigorous.You’ll keep up a regular schedule of refreshing (or “feeding”) the starter twice a day, every 12 hours, until it doubles in size within six to eight hours. This can take anywhere from five to 14 days, depending on conditions. (So if you’re not seeing much activity, just be patient! And feel free to call our Baker’s Hotline for troubleshooting and advice.) Once the starter has reached this point, you can start baking with it or keep maintaining it until ready to use. (See “How to maintain sourdough starter” below.)Instead of taking days to make a starter from scratch, you can have one delivered in the mail. Our fresh sourdough starter is a mature, ready-to-use sourdough culture. You’ll just need to refresh it with flour and water (in other words, “feed” it) until it’s bubbly and doubles in size within six to eight hours. Then, it’s ready to bake, or to be stored and maintained until you want to use it. (See “How to maintain sourdough starter” below.) Wait, did someone give you some of their starter? If someone gifts you some of their starter, the best thing to do is to feed it immediately. Combine equal parts (by weight) starter, flour, and water, and let sit at room temperature. Gauge how active the sourdough starter is: Did it double in volume in six to eight hours? If so, it’s ready to store and maintain for future use, or to bake with right now.Did the starter not double in volume? Feed it again. Continue these maintenance feeds every 12 hours at room temperature until the starter doubles in size in six to eight hours. Then get baking, or store it according to your maintenance schedule.How to maintain sourdough starterGenerally, there are two routines you may choose to maintain your sourdough starter. Depending on your choice, here’s how often to feed sourdough starter:1. Twice daily at room temperature: If you’re a regular sourdough baker, the best way to have ripe starter when you need it is to keep your starter on the counter at room temperature and feed it twice daily, about every 12 hours.2. Once a week in the fridge: If you’re a more casual sourdough baker, it’s easiest to keep your starter in the fridge and feed it once a week. (We recommend leaving it on the counter for a few hours after feeding to start fermenting before returning it to the fridge.) Then, a day or two before you want to bake, give it a couple of feedings at room temperature before using it to bake.To feed sourdough starter, you simply discard some of the existing starter, then replace it with flour and water. Essentially, you’re giving the starter’s microorganisms food (in the form of flour) to keep them happy and healthy. Once fed, the starter will become active and bubbly again, doubling in volume before it exhausts itself and begins to sink back down.

Fava beans, also known as broad beans, are legumes regularly consumed in Southern Europe, Northern Europe, East Asia, Latin America and North Africa. Most popular during springtime when they’re harvested, fava beans are one of the oldest known foods and have been cultivated and consumed for nearly 10,000 years.Quickly becoming popular worldwide, fava beans are available at most grocery stores in dried, canned and fresh varieties. You can use these beans to make soup, stews, paste and even falafel. And while there’s no doubt that this legume is excellent tasting, one of the questions often asked is if it has any health benefits. If you plan on cooking with fava beans and want to ensure that you add nutritional value to your meals, you’re in luck. This article will dive into fava beans health benefits and provide recipes you can try today.The Benefits of Fava BeansThe benefits of fava beans are plentiful. Fava beans are rich in many nutrients, which promote better health in unique ways. Since cultivation, fava beans have been used to treat many ailments and are one of the most inexpensive ways to meet your daily nutrient requirements. Continue reading to learn more about the benefits of fava beans and what makes them a great addition to a healthy diet.Fava Beans Are a Source of FolateFava beans are a quality source of folate—a vital vitamin for energy metabolism. Sufficient folate levels support the nervous system’s function and assist in synthesizing DNA, RNA, and red blood cells. Eating a diet rich in beans can help boost your folate intake and may decrease your risk of certain diseases and depression. Fava Beans Increase Iron IntakeMeeting your daily requirement for iron is essential to good health. Iron helps produce red blood cells and provides your body with a primary cellular energy source known as adenosine triphosphate, or ATP. A diet lacking iron may make you more susceptible to developing anemia and other health problems. One serving—1/4 cup of fava beans—provides 10% of your daily recommended iron intake. The iron found in fava beans is in non-heme form and not as easily absorbed by the body. However, you can quickly increase the amount that you absorb by combining fava beans with meat or a source of vitamin C. Enjoying fava beans as a side dish to steak, chicken, or fish is an excellent way to incorporate both forms of iron into your diet.Fava Beans Contain Dietary FiberIncorporating fava beans into your meals can work wonders for your digestive health. Like most legumes, fava beans contain two types of fiber—soluble and insoluble. However, they are especially rich in insoluble fiber. Insoluble fiber promotes a healthy digestive system, regularity and a balanced gut biome, and eating adequate amounts of it will help keep your body feeling its best. 1/4 cup of cooked fava beans supplies 29% of an adult’s daily dietary fiber requirement.Fava Beans Are an Excellent Meat SubstituteFava beans are a good source of protein and iron, making them a fantastic meat substitute. Protein is a nutrient required by the body to perform basic tasks, and without it, It’s nearly impossible for us to function. Our skin, brain cells, muscles, hair and nails all require protein to remain healthy and strong. The issue is that many people following a plant-based diet find it hard to fill their meals with protein-rich ingredients. Meat is often recognized as one of the most protein-rich foods around. However, many plant-based protein sources, like fava beans, provide just as much, if not more, of it. Let’s get started!Tapioca PowderTapioca is a starch that derives from the cassava root. This starch is extracted through a process of washing and pulping. Once enough wet pulp has been gathered, it is then squeezed to extract the starchy liquid. This cassava starch is a dietary staple in various countries in Africa, Asia and South America.Tapioca starch is an essential ingredient in gluten free baking and a favorite amongst those following a paleo diet. Naturally gluten free, tapioca flour can serve as a wheat substitute in a variety of gluten free recipes.Because this cassava starch is both odorless and tasteless, it makes it easy to add to any recipe (savory or sweet) without changing the flavor of the recipe itself. When added to baked goods, tapioca starch helps the ingredients properly bind together.A function that gluten is often used for. Tapioca starch’s binding abilities help bakers achieve baked goods that are fluffy, light and spongy in texture. Like many other starches, tapioca flour can also be used as a thickening agent in soups, stews and puddings.How to Cook with Tapioca Flour Have some tapioca flour in your cupboard that you’re not sure how to use? We’ve got you covered. Like other starches, tapioca flour works as a great thickening agent when added to liquid-based foods. However, there are a few differences between tapioca flour and other starches. One of the most notable differences is that tapioca flour retains its texture even after it’s been frozen. This means that when using tapioca starch, you no longer have to worry about freezing the leftover soup you’ve made. Simply place it in the freezer, let it thaw once you’re ready to eat, and enjoy! When baking or cooking with tapioca flour, we recommend using it alongside other gluten free flours such as almond flour. This will help ensure that your recipe achieves the desired consistency. It’s also important to note how much liquid is in the recipe.When combined with liquid, tapioca flour will turn into a paste-like substance that can then be stirred into the rest of the recipe. Tapioca flour’s water-absorbing capabilities make it perfect when adding moisture to baked recipes or used to thicken sauces. Because it is tasteless and odorless, it can be added to a recipe without changing the flavor.Use It as a Thickening AgentWant to thicken your favorite soup recipe without using traditional flour? Use tapioca flour! Despite its name, tapioca flour is a starch that makes a great gluten free thickener. Instead of using wheat flour to thicken a soup or dressing, you can use tapioca flour to achieve the same effect. Commonly substituted at a 1:1 1/2 ratio, we recommend first creating a slurry of tapioca flour and then adding it to your recipe. Doing so will ensure that the tapioca flour is evenly distributed and help prevent clumping.Another thing we love about tapioca flour is the ability to enhance the appearance of a dish. When combined with liquid, tapioca flour will give a meal a glossy finish, unlike cornstarch, which is known for producing more of a matte finish. While a glossy finish works well with pies and salad dressings, it might not be the perfect match for a gravy dish. Knowing how and when to use tapioca flour is key to perfecting your favorite recipe.Use It to Add Structure to Baked GoodsTapioca flour is excellent for baking! Especially when it comes to gluten free goods. Adding just the right amount of tapioca flour to your baked treats will create a light, airy, crispy and chewy texture. Perfect for adding to bread, cookies, brownies and pie crusts, tapioca flour is a great way to ensure that your ingredients bind together without using gluten! When measuring out tapioca flour, it’s crucial to get it just right. While adding the right amount will help you achieve the perfect texture, adding too much could turn your treats into a gummy mess.Use it to Make Bubble TeaLastly, step out of your kitchen comfort zone and use tapioca flour to make bubble tea! To make a perfect tapioca pearl dough or boba pearl, simply add hot water and food coloring to tapioca flour. Then follow along with your favorite bubble tea recipe to create the perfect boba pearl. A fun and unique treat, be sure to buy extra-wide straws to drink your milk tea with tapioca balls. It’s half the fun!The Difference Between Tapioca Flour and Cassava FlourYou may be wondering what the difference between tapioca flour and cassava flour is, especially since they both come from the same plant. While the terms tapioca flour and cassava flour may sometimes be used interchangeably, these two flours are incredibly different. As we discussed earlier, tapioca flour is made by extracting the starch from the cassava root through a method of washing and pulping.Cassava flour, on the other hand, uses a significantly different method. When making cassava flour, the whole root of the cassava plant is used. To make this flour, the root is peeled, dried, and ground. Because the entire root is used, cassava has much more dietary fiber than tapioca flour, which creates a different result when adding to recipes. Ready to start adding tapioca flour to your recipes? From homemade breads to braised meat, the Dutch oven is a piece of cookware that finds itself on the wishlists of home chefs everywhere. It’s typically made from seasoned or enameled cast iron or ceramic and is able to withstand high heat. A versatile kitchen essential, the Dutch oven comes ready to handle most cooking tasks, keeps your food warm and waiting for extended periods of time, and tends to produce richly flavored end results that dinner guests swoon over. If you are a home chef that wants to take their cooking skills to the next level, then a classic enameled Dutch oven just might be a worthy investment.This article is going to answer the questions “What is a dutch oven and what is it used for?” Keep reading to learn about the many benefits and uses of this cast iron cookware.BreadOne of the easiest (and more surprising) ways to use a Dutch oven is actually for breaking bread. About a decade ago, professional baker Jim Lahey found that perfectly golden bread could be made without the need for kneading, instead shaping it in his Dutch oven. Since then, bread enthusiasts everywhere have purchased the classic Dutch oven with only one desire: to bake incredible loaves of homemade bread with little effort right in the comfort of their own kitchens. White flour is white flour — but not all white flour is created equal. Differences in milling, as well as how the flour is treated after it’s milled, can have big impacts on flour. And one of the primary ways flour is treated is through bleaching. Refined wheat flours (i.e., not whole wheat), such as all-purpose flour, cake flour, and self-rising flour, are either bleached or unbleached during production. But what exactly does that mean? In brief: Unbleached flour is naturally aged after milling, during which time it slowly oxidizes and whitens. Bleached flour, on the other hand, uses chemical treatments to manually speed up this process. Both can be used interchangeably in baking; so why should you choose one over the other? Let’s break it down a little more.Understanding the difference between bleached and unbleached flourDuring the 1940s (the heyday of Wonder Bread, the first sliced bread on the market), white flour became a popular fixture in commercial bread. And while Wonder Bread is no longer the only, nor the most popular, bread on the market, contemporary millers are still primarily in the business of making white flour. The first step in accomplishing this is to separate the bran and germ of the wheat berry through the milling process itself. That’s what distinguishes whole wheat flour, which is made from the entire wheat kernel, from white flour, which is only the milled endosperm.The next step in this process is to “whiten” the remaining flour. Given time and exposure to air, flour will slowly oxidize and whiten on its own. This rest period, around two weeks in the summer and up to a month in the winter, also changes flour’s chemistry so that it will create a dough that is more elastic. This is unbleached flour, and it’s how King Arthur Baking Company makes all of our refined flours. But rather than using time as an agent, as we do, many millers use chemicals to whiten flour almost instantly. As the flour comes off the line at the mill, bleaching and oxidizing chemicals are added in order to quicken or entirely replace the aging process. This is how bleached flour is made. Wait, what exactly does “bleached” mean?The chemicals used to whiten and/or oxidize flour include chlorine dioxide, benzoyl peroxide, and chlorine gas, all of which are currently permissible additives (though King Arthur Baking Company flours do not contain any of them). Benzoyl peroxide leaves behind some benzoic acid; some people with an acute sense of taste recognize benzoyl peroxide in baked goods because it has a bitter aftertaste, but its addition does not appreciably change its baking qualities. Chlorine gas reacts with the flour to change its absorbency, flavor, pH, and, in the case of some cake flours, its performance. In baked goods where other ingredients do not mask it, it imparts a detectable flavor to people with sensitive palates.The most controversial additive used today is potassium bromate, which is still in use both as an oxidizer and an “improver,” strengthening dough and allowing for greater oven spring and higher rising in the oven. It has come under scrutiny, however, as tests with it have indicated that it is carcinogenic in animals and probably in humans. Since 1991, flour sold in California containing potassium bromate has had to carry a warning label, and it was recently banned in the state as well. It is also banned in Canada, Europe, and Japan, and will likely someday be banned in other parts of the United States. (This is why King Arthur bags proclaim that our flour is “Never Bromated.”)Choosing the right flourUltimately, the flour you choose to bake with is entirely up to you. Bleached and unbleached flours can both be used interchangeably in any recipe without a major discernable difference. But understanding what sets them apart can help you make your decision.

Continue reading for a complete guide covering all there is to know about this plant-based cooking product and how you can make it from scratch.Where Does Seitan Come From?While seitan has recently gained popularity, it’s not a new product. Instead, it’s a vegan meat substitute that has been around for years and more recently emerged with a new name. Enjoyed in China as early as the 6th century, the seitan was initially known as “mian jin” and served for centuries.However, in the 1960s, mian jin received a “makeover” by George Ohsawa, who founded the macrobiotic diet and introduced seitan as a new term combining the two Japanese words:1. “sei”: made of2. “tanpaku”: meaning proteinWhat Is Seitan? What is seitan, exactly?A popular meat substitute used primarily in vegetarian and vegan meals, seitan is often referred to by many different names, including wheat meat, gluten meat, vital wheat gluten, and gluten. It’s made by combining two ingredients—wheat gluten and water—and is a soy-free alternative to many of the meat-free products available for individuals following a plant-based diet.But what is the difference between seitan vs tempeh? When cooked, seitan takes on a meaty texture that is both dense and chewy. Because its texture is similar to that of meat, most people prefer it to tofu or tempeh when making a genuinely meaty dish. Additionally, seitan absorbs flavor exceptionally well, making it easy to include in various cuisines ranging from sweet and savory to spicy.Luckily, making this versatile ingredient at home is easy. Creating seitan requires you to knead vital wheat gluten and water until it forms into a firm ball or loaf. Wheat flour or additional ingredients can be added to improve the texture; however, they’re not always needed.After the dough has been formed into a ball, it is rinsed and boiled to wash away the starches. Seitan can be used to create everything from vegan chicken strips to plant-based taco meat and is a favorite amongst vegetarians and meat-eaters alike.Can Everyone Enjoy Seitan?Ideal for those following a plant-based diet and people who have a soy allergy, seitan is entirely soy free and high in protein, making it an excellent choice. That being said, while seitan is a delicious meat alternative, it’s not for everyone. If you’re gluten intolerant or have celiac disease, seitan is unfortunately not the meat substitute for you.Made entirely of wheat gluten, seitan is not a gluten-free food and shouldn’t be treated as such. Additionally, while seitan contains high amounts of protein, it is not a complete protein source. Because of this, it must be combined with other sources of protein when you eat it. Ingredients like chickpea flour, soy flour, and soy sauce can be added to your seitan dough to complete the string of essential amino acids.Seitan Ingredients While seitan can be made in several different ways, here’s an overview of how to make seitan and the ingredients commonly used in this dish.Vital Wheat GlutenVital wheat gluten, also known as gluten, is a protein naturally found in wheat. Commonly used in bread baking, when a small amount is added, it improves the texture and elasticity of the dough. Additionally, it’s the main ingredient used to make seitan and helps create a chewy, meaty texture.Nutritional YeastNutritional yeast is a top-rated vegetarian dietary supplement. Known for its pleasantly cheesy flavor, it’s loaded with good-for-you nutrients like vitamin B-12 and protein. Mix it into your favorite sauces, or add it to plant-based alternatives to recreate traditional flavors.Spices and FlavoringsSeitan soaks up whatever is around it as dehydrated food, making it an easy ingredient to flavor. To make a delicious lunch or dinner seitan recipe that tastes similar to meat, we recommend using herbs and spices like garlic, onion, fennel, turmeric, soy sauce, molasses, tahini, and olive oil.Broth or LiquidSeitan is a dehydrated food, which means that it needs to be rehydrated before enjoying it. While seitan can be rehydrated using water, the result will often be a bit bland, especially if other flavorings are not added to the recipe. To rehydrate your seitan and flavor it simultaneously, choose a pre-flavored liquid like soup or vegetable broth.How to Make Homemade Seitan from Scratch Making basic seitan in the comfort of your kitchen is easy. Keep scrolling for a step-by-step guide to make seitan from scratch.What you’ll need:1. Medium bowl (2)2. Whisk3. Basic seitan ingredients4. 18-inch-long sheet of aluminum foil5. Measuring cup6. Medium pot and lid7. Steamer basketIngredients1. 1 ¾ cups Wheat Gluten2. ⅓ cup Nutritional Yeast3. 2 tsp Garlic Granules or Garlic Powder4. 1 tsp Onion Powder5. 2 tsp Crushed Fennel6. ½ tsp Turmeric7. 3 Tbsp Soy Sauce8. 1 tsp Molasses9. 1 tsp Tahini10. 1 ½ Tbsp Oil11. 1 ½ cups Mushroom or Vegetable BrothStep 1:Start with wheat gluten. In a medium bowl, combine the wheat gluten, nutritional yeast, and dry spices—whisk them together. Combine the remaining ingredients in a separate bowl and stir until they’re smooth.Step 2:Form a well in the dry ingredients and pour the wet mixture in slowly. Use a fork to bring the dough together until you notice that it’s lumpy and springy.Step 3:Pour the mixed dough onto a sheet of aluminum foil (or parchment paper) and wrap it, forming it into a log-like shape.Step 4:Bring 4-6 cups of water to a rolling boil in a medium pot and place a steamer basket inside. Next, add the seitan that’s been wrapped in foil and cover the pot with a lid allowing 80 minutes of cook time without removing the lid.Step 5:Once the seitan is done steaming, allow it to cool for 30 minutes before cutting it into slices or chunks. Enjoy your cooked seitan as is, sear it on the stovetop, or combine it with another recipe to create a truly satisfying meal.Ways to Cook Seitan Now that you know how to make homemade seitan, it’s time to decide how you’d like to cook it. Seitan can be baked, steamed, or boiled, which will all result in different textures. Whether you are looking to make vegan seitan patties, a steak, sausage, or a stir fry, there are many dishes you can make once you’ve created the seitan dough. Before determining how you’d like to cook this vegan meat substitute, we recommend finding a recipe to add it to first. Knowing what you’ll be combining the seitan with will help you decide what method to use.Simmering SeitanTo simmer seitan, you’ll want to begin with a pot and a large portion of it. Instead of cooking your seitan in boiling water, ensure that you have simmering broth (vegetable broth or vegan chicken broth) or water and cook it until it’s fully done. Though proper simmering can be achieved with water alone, for a boost of flavor and nutrients, season the seitan with vegetable stock, soy sauce, miso paste, nutritional yeast, and other spices.Because the seitan will be set directly into the liquid, it will soak up its flavors and develop a soft and spongy texture. Though delicious, this smooth texture won’t hold up well in firm dishes and is best when added to soups, pasta, and stews.Steaming SeitanTo get properly steamed seitan, you will need a steamer or a steaming basket that can be easily set up in a pot. Making steamed seitan is easy, first, bring the water in the pot to a simmer and then add the seitan to the steaming basket.This process will allow the seitan to develop a pleasant texture that is neither too soft nor too firm. Instead of creating a crust, the outer layers of the seitan will remain smooth, ideal for combining with other steamed foods like vegetables.Baking SeitanIf you want to create a portion of seitan with a firmer consistency, we recommend baking it in the oven. Because the baking process will slightly dehydrate the seitan, it will create a firm texture and crusting outside. To bake it to perfection, simply place the seitan on a lightly greased baking sheet and bake at 180°C – 200°C/360°F – 390°F. Sourdough baking seems like it should be easy, right?After all, people have been baking naturally fermented bread for thousands of years, and it only requires three ingredients: flour, water, and salt. Well, it’s simple, but creating a starter and baking sourdough bread’s not easy — at least not until you develop your own personal process, something that works for both you and your starter.Everything from the flour you use to the season of the year to whether you’re urban or rural plays into your sourdough bread success — or less-than-success. Talk about variables!If you’re a new sourdough baker, you may be struggling just trying to get your starter going. The confusion, angst, and even despair that we hear among first-time sourdough bakers out there is truly distressing.Are you having a rough time with your starter? Let us help. Here are 10 tips directed specifically at brand-new sourdough bakers that should clear up the confusion you’re feeling around not just the starter itself, but the various tools and recipes associated with sourdough baking.1) My starter recipe says to begin with [X] flour. Can I use a different flour instead?Sourdough starter is a combination of water and flour which, when mixed together, grows wild yeast, produces organic acids, and attracts friendly bacteria. All flours, from whole grain rye to all-purpose white, harbor wild yeast and will cultivate bacteria. But not all flours work the same: some are better right at the beginning of your starter’s life, while others have more to contribute farther along in the process.Maybe you have a good supply of bread flour but your starter recipe calls for all-purpose (or vice versa). Perhaps the formula lists organic rye flour or golden whole wheat, and you simply don’t have them and can’t get them. No worries; just use what you have.If your starter calls for all-purpose flour and all you have is bread flour, increase the water a bit; if it calls for bread flour and all you have is all-purpose, decrease the water a bit. And if it calls for whole wheat or rye and you have neither? Your starter may be a bit slower coming to life without the initial “kick” of a whole grain, but eventually it’ll work just fine. (Learn more about how whole grain flours affect starter in our post: Sluggish starter? Add a little whole grain flour.)One caveat: Bleached flour may eventually yield a decent starter, but due to its natural flora having been killed by bleaching it’ll probably take a heck of a lot longer for a starter made with bleached flour to become fully active. 2) I read that you should never use a plastic bowl or metal spoon around sourdough starter. Is that true?No, not at all. Our Baking School keeps its starter in food-safe plastic buckets and uses metal spoons or acrylic spatulas to mix it up after feeding. We wouldn’t recommend using a bowl that’ll react with sourdough’s acidity — for instance, don’t mix or store your starter in cast iron or uncoated aluminum — but other than that, glass, plastic, stoneware, acrylic, stainless steel — take your pick, all are acceptable.3) Do I have to feed my starter with pure spring water or bottled water?No. While chlorine and other chemicals in your treated tap water don’t create the friendliest environment for your starter, there’s no need to make a trip to the store for bottled water.I’ve successfully used tap water in my starter for years. If your tap water is so heavily treated you can smell the chemicals, try filling an open container and leaving it at room temperature overnight. The next day your water should be good to go. 4) My new starter was very bubbly and doubling in size within 6 to 8 hours, but now it’s seemed to go dormant. Is it dead?It’s certainly discouraging to see a starter that’s seemed perfectly happy suddenly turn into a lifeless blob. But it’s OK. As your new starter evolves, one set of bacteria gradually gives way to another; and during that transition, when neither is dominant, your starter will take a rest. Just keep feeding it; within a few days, it should show renewed signs of life. 5) Do I really have to throw away so much starter when I’m feeding it? It seems wasteful.If you don’t remove some of your starter before feeding it, you’ll soon have gallons of the stuff filling your fridge. So yes, you do have to remove some starter; but you don’t necessarily have to throw it away. Here are your options:1. Give your excess starter to a friend to start his or her own starter.2. Turn it into something yummy. Within the first 4 or 5 days of your starter’s life, it won’t taste very good and probably shouldn’t be used for baking; but after that, there are many, many delicious ways to use it. See our collection of sourdough discard recipes for inspiration.3. Substitute it for some of the flour and water in your non-sourdough recipe. For details, see adding sourdough to a recipe.4. You also have the option of building and maintaining a much smaller starter, one that’s fed and discarded in tablespoons rather than cups. See our recipe for a smaller sourdough starter.6) What’s the best container for storing my starter?Something with a lid! Seriously, you can go two ways here. If you want to feed and store your starter in the same container, you want one that’s large enough to hold triple your volume of starter. If you’ll be feeding your starter in a bowl and then transferring it to a lidded container to store, the container only needs to be a bit larger than the starter itself. It’s handy to use a clear glass or translucent plastic container if you’ll be letting your starter rise in it, so you can track its progress. (Our glass sourdough crock is a preferred option.) Stoneware, plastic, stainless steel, and enameled metal are also suitable materials.Whatever vessel you choose, the lid should fit securely, simply to prevent potential spillage if you knock the container over. But you don’t want anything airtight: it’s not necessary and could potentially result in a messy blowout. 7) My starter develops lots of small bubbles when I feed it, but it’s not really rising very well. Is that OK?Not if you’re going to use it to leaven bread! A fed starter should double in size within 6 to 8 hours, or it probably won’t be strong enough to raise your dough.Sometimes starter is so thin and liquid-y that there’s not enough structure for it to expand; bubbles simply rise and escape. If your starter seems thin (easily pourable rather than gloppy), try feeding it a bit more flour until it thickens up; alternatively, you can feed it with higher-protein (higher-absorption) bread flour. This might be just what it needs to start growing up, rather than fizzling out.8) “I think I killed my starter!”No, you almost certainly didn’t. While sourdough starter can die under extreme circumstances (e.g., having been fed with boiling water), it’s actually really hard to kill. It may be poky and slow; it may not look like you think it should. But it’s not dead. Keep feeding it on a regular schedule and eventually, it’ll start bubbling again.Now, sourdough starter can very rarely become “infected” with mold or an evil bacteria, in which case you won’t want to bake with it. If your starter shows evident signs of mold or if it develops a pink/orange tinge, it’s time to discard it and start again.When it comes to how your starter smells, it’s fairly common for a fledgling starter to go through a stinky period (think teenagers’ sneakers), but an established starter should never smell awful. That being said, if you’ve neglected your starter in the refrigerator longer than usual and it smells a little off, a few days of room-temperature feedings will likely restore it to its usual pleasant aroma.For more on how to assess your starter’s health see our post, Sourdough starter troubleshooting.9) I’m ready to bake bread. But do I really need to buy a banneton, rice flour, and a Dutch oven?No. These all come under the heading of nice to have, but not necessary.A banneton (a.k.a. brotform) is simply a round or oval basket that holds dough as it rises. The risen loaf is then turned out onto a baking stone, a baking sheet, or into a Dutch oven to bake. It’s useful for doughs that are quite soft and need support, keeping them from flattening out as they expand.You can actually fashion your own rising vessel from a bowl and smooth dish towel, for soft dough. For a stiffer dough, simply allow the loaf to rise on a piece of parchment (which makes it easy to transfer to a hot baking stone); on the baking sheet on which you’ll bake it, or even in your Dutch oven if you decide not to preheat it first.Rice flour is used to flour your banneton; it’s “slipperier” than regular all-purpose or bread flour and offers better release of the potentially sticky dough but again, not necessary.A Dutch oven or other closed container is a real boon if you enjoy bread with excellent loft and supremely crusty crust. The container’s lid catches steam from the baking loaf, keeping its top crust soft and allowing it to expand fully. That same steam makes the crust crackly-crisp once the loaf has finished rising and the bread starts to brown.Yes, a Dutch oven is great to have; see the details here: Bread baking in a Dutch oven. But you can certainly bake a lovely loaf without one.10) Can you point me to a really simple recipe to get started?Our Rustic Sourdough Bread is perfect for beginners. Since it includes a bit of commercial yeast as well as sourdough starter, you don’t have to worry about your starter being totally up to snuff: Call it the belt and suspenders approach. While sourdough purists will argue that using commercial yeast disqualifies your bread as “true” sourdough, hey, what’s in a name? If you enjoy a light-textured, crusty loaf with lovely tang, this one’s for you.Our Naturally Leavened Sourdough Bread includes no commercial yeast, and relies entirely on a strong starter for its rise. So if you choose this recipe make sure your fed starter is very healthy and active, doubling in size within 6 to 8 hours of feeding. If your starter is ready to go, expect to make a loaf with great crust and chew, and deep, rich sourdough flavor.The last word on sourdough bakingThe wild yeast and friendly bacteria that bring sourdough starter to life are fickle, just like all living organisms. Sometimes they’re full of energy and ready to rise and shine; other times they need coddling and cajoling. It’s up to you to figure out what your starter needs — and when — in order to keep it happy and working for you.It sounds daunting, but don’t be discouraged. Gradually, as you learn what works in your kitchen (rather than what works for that guy on YouTube or your best friend in Seattle) you’ll relax and realize that hey, sourdough bread’s not that complicated after all. It’s flour, water, salt, and time — both the hours it takes your loaves to rise, and the days you spend learning about this ancient craft through practice, practice, and more practice.Now, take a deep breath and relax. “Did I kill my starter?” This is a surprisingly common sourdough question on our we receive. Novice and experienced bakers alike worry about the viability of their starters and call us for sourdough starter troubleshooting advice.For many sourdough bakers, the underlying biochemistry at work in their starter remains a bit of a mystery. Thankfully, it’s quite possible to bake great sourdough bread while still being a little fuzzy when it comes to what’s actually happening in that little jar of starter.The 6 to 10 days it takes to create a healthy and mature sourdough starter from scratch requires slightly more attention to “death threats,” because a fledgling starter hasn’t yet developed the defenses that characterize a mature starter. But once your starter is fully developed, it’s really pretty darn hard to kill.And if you’ve purchased a sourdough starter from us, rest assured that it’s a mature specimen that will stand up well against unwanted bacteria or mold. Things that WON’T kill your sourdough starterMETAL: Stirring your starter with a metal spoon or placing it in a metal bowl won’t kill your starter. While we don’t recommend making or keeping your starter in contact with reactive metals like copper or aluminum, stainless steel is harmless.MILD NEGLECT: Missing a feeding or not timing the feedings exactly 12 hours apart won’t even come close to killing your starter. Please don’t ever set your alarm to get up in the middle of the night to feed your starter!INCORRECT FEEDINGS: Feeding your starter the wrong amount of flour or water won’t kill it. While your starter may seem too dry or too wet, and may not rise the way you expect, no permanent damage has been done. You can correct its consistency by adding a little more flour or water, and then being more careful the next time you feed it.BRIEFLY FREEZING YOUR STARTER: While there’s some dispute among sourdough enthusiasts about the benefits and/or dangers of freezing sourdough starter, a brief period in the freezer isn’t likely to kill a fully developed starter.I recently froze a portion of my well-maintained starter a few hours after it was fed. Three days later I thawed it out at room temperature and let it continue to ferment. It was definitely sluggish at first, but after a second feeding it rose well and had a good aroma.That being said, too much time in the freezer will definitely damage some of the wild yeast in your starter, and is also likely to kill off some of the friendly bacteria that contribute flavor. If you need to put your starter on hold for an extended time, we recommend drying your starter.Things that WILL kill your sourdough starterHEAT: If you allow your sourdough starter to ferment in the oven with the light on to keep it warm, and then forget it’s in there and turn on the oven, it’s unlikely your starter will make it out alive. Yeast dies at 140°F, and it’s likely that your sourdough starter will suffer at temperatures even lower than that. It’s best to maintain your starter at comfortable room temperature (around 70°F), though a little higher or lower won’t hurt anything.SEVERE NEGLECT: If you neglect your starter long enough, it will develop mold or signs of being overtaken by bad bacteria. Mold can appear in various colors and is typically fuzzy in appearance. Bad bacteria is generally indicated by an orange or pink tinge or streak. Once your starter has lost its natural ability to ward off intruders, it’s time to start over.How to tell if your starter has gone bad“Hooch” is the liquid that collects on the top of your starter when it hasn’t been fed in awhile. This liquid is the alcohol given off as wild yeast ferments. The presence of hooch isn’t a sign that your starter is in danger. However, it does indicate that your starter is hungry and needs to be fed.When your starter is neglected for an extended period, the hooch tends to turn from clear to dark-colored. We get lots of calls from sourdough bakers worried about the safety or danger of various hooch hues. Is gray bad? What about brown or black? Surprisingly, none of these colors indicate that your starter has spoiled.See the orange streak? This starter shouldn’t be saved.However, if you see a pink or orange tint or streak, this is a sure sign that your sourdough starter has gone bad and should be discarded. The stiff starter above was left out at room temperature for two weeks. It’s definitely time to throw it out and start over.Sourdough starter troubleshooting: points to remember1. Well-maintained mature sourdough starters are extremely hardy and resistant to invaders. It’s pretty darn hard to kill them.2. Throw out your starter and start over if it shows visible signs of mold, or an orange or pink tint/streak.I hope you’ll share your own sourdough starter questions and discoveries below. Starting your journey as a bread baker? It can be daunting — so many confusing terms! — but once you understand what everything means, the process becomes much clearer. Here, we’re diving into one of the most crucial steps to making homemade bread: proofing.What is bread proofing?Everyone knows that bread dough rises, right? Well, that’s basically what proofing means! It’s when bread dough is left to ferment — the yeast (commercial yeast or sourdough culture) consumes the sugars and starches in the dough and expels carbon dioxide — which causes the dough to expand as it traps the carbon dioxide within its strong and stretchy gluten network. As bread proofs, it typically doubles (or nearly doubles) in size, becoming puffy and pillowy.Professional bakers often use terms that are different from the ones used by home bakers. In this case, there are several different terms that are used interchangeably to describe this step. Other words and terms that refer to proofing include rise and fermentation.Which leads to the next point: Bread dough is usually left to rise two different times in the baking process, and proofing technically refers to just the second of these rises but is often used to describe both.Why do you proof bread dough multiple times? And what is bulk fermentation?In a standard bread recipe — take Classic Sandwich Bread for instance — the bread dough is mixed and kneaded, then left in a covered bowl to rise (usually, but not always, doubling in size). This step is often called first rise, first proof, bulk fermentation, or bulk proof. It typically takes around 1 to 2 hours, depending on the dough and the environment in which it’s left to rise.Once the dough has undergone bulk fermentation, it is shaped. In this example, it’s shaped into a sandwich loaf and placed in a bread pan, but this also applies if you’re shaping a boule, a bâtard, or even rolls. Once shaped, the dough is left to proof a second time — this is the step that “proofing” technically refers to. Much of the air was knocked out of the dough while shaping, so this is a chance for the dough to expand again before baking. This step is sometimes called second rise or second proof. What is the best bread proofing temperature?One of the biggest keys to successfully proofing bread dough is temperature. Yeast thrives best in a warm environment, and the warmer the conditions, the quicker your dough will proof. “Breads do well in the low to mid-70s, between 72°F to 78°F,” says Baking Ambassador Martin Philip. “That’s just the right range to encourage yeast activity without having your dough move so fast that it overproofs or fails to develop flavor.”Martin prefers an electric folding bread proofer, which allows him to control the temperature and environment in which his bread proofs. But you can also be intentional about where in your kitchen or home you place your bread to proof to ensure you have the best environment — and temperature — for yeast to thrive.Where should I proof bread dough?Ideally, you want to find the warmest spot in your house, where cozy temperatures will encourage yeast activity. Options include:1. Near a radiator or wood stove2. The top of your fridge3. The inside of your (turned off) oven with the oven light on4. Your empty dryer: Spin it for a couple of minutes to warm it up, then turn it off and pop your container of dough inside5. On top of a heating pad (on low) or dough riser6. In a temperature-controlled proofing box7. In your microwave, with a cup of boiling water tucked in beside itIf you’re baking bread in the summer or your house is naturally warm, you may not need to go with any of these options — your kitchen counter may be warm enough. A digital thermometer is a helpful way to gauge the temperature of your bread throughout proofing: If it stays around 72°F, it’s fine where it is. If it drops in temperature, consider moving to a warmer spot.How should I cover my proofing bread dough?While many cookbooks recommend using a tea towel to cover rising dough, we don’t agree. “Draping your dough with a kitchen towel is not a sufficient cover — your dough will dry out, forming a skin,” says Martin. “Use an airtight lid, bowl cover, or plastic wrap instead.” If you’re doing a lot of bread baking, consider a lidded dough-rising bucket. A dough-rising bucket provides an airtight cover and markings to gauge when your dough actually doubles in size.How long does it take to proof bread?It depends! (Not a very satisfying answer, we know.) Recipes typically include time ranges (“Let rise for 1 to 1 1/2 hours”), but these should be considered guidelines, not hard and fast rules. Instead, use visual clues to determine if your dough is well-proofed — more on that next.How can I tell if my bread dough is done proofing?If the dough is supposed to double in size during bulk fermentation, place it in a straight-sided container with markings on the side so you can easily and accurately tell when it has doubled in volume.If you’re proofing shaped sandwich bread dough in a loaf pan, look for the dough to rise 1″ over the lip of the pan. (Don’t guess, use a ruler to measure!)For freeform loaves, use the poke test to determine proofing: Lightly flour your finger and poke the dough down about 1″. If the indent stays, it’s ready to bake. If it pops back out, give it a bit more time. See more guidelines here: How do I know if my bread dough has risen enough?And remember: As a general rule, if your dough is proofing in a cool environment, it will take longer. If it’s proofing in a warm environment, it will be quicker. When sandwich bread dough rises 1″ over the rim of the pan, it’s time to bake!For better bread, nail your proof“Proofing is every bit as important as the other foundational aspects of bread making, from mixing to baking,” says Martin. “It’s key to bread’s structure, oven spring, and the beauty of the final loaf.”While proofing may be the most passive step in bread baking — you literally sit back and wait — it’s also one of the most crucial. Being mindful of how you cover your dough, where you place it, and when you bake it will set you up for baking success and better bread.

After all the work it takes to make bread, not to mention time (sometimes multiple days!), the last thing you want to do is stumble at the final hurdle. But that’s exactly what can happen if you underbake your bread — resulting in a gummy, dense crumb — or overbake it, causing it to harden and dry out.Should I use temperature to test my bread for doneness?You can. Many of our recipes call for loaves to be baked to a specific internal temperature, as measured on an instant-read thermometer. (For specifics, check out this blog post: Using a thermometer with yeast bread.) But as a seasoned bread baker, Barb recommends methods that pros, home bakers, and grandmas alike have been using for centuries.“I learned to bake bread at an artisan bakery, and we never took the temperature of our breads,” Barb says. “Professional bakers simply don’t tend to use this method. Instead, I encourage bakers to learn to use their senses to guide them: the aroma, color, feel, and sound of the loaf can provide all the confirmation you need that your bread is fully baked.” An instant-read thermometer can measure the internal temperature of your loaf.Use your senses to gauge doneness (more on that below!), and then turn to a thermometer as a way to confirm your instincts and ensure the bread is fully baked. It’s a secondary tool, rather than the only one. This is especially important because the center of a loaf can reach its “finished” baking temperature several minutes before the end of baking time, so only using temperature can sometimes be misleading.Use your senses: Smell“Just like other baked goods, when the delectable aroma of homemade bread starts wafting through your kitchen, that’s a good sign that your bread is close to being done,” advises Barb. Don’t stray too far from your oven at this point!Use your senses: Sound“For crusty artisan bread, one way to determine doneness is by thumping the bottom of the loaf,” says Barb. “Give it a few quick knocks on the bottom of the loaf with your knuckles; if it sounds hollow, that tells you it’s fully baked.”Use your senses: TouchNo matter what type of bread you’re baking, the finished loaf should feel noticeably lighter in weight than the dough did. “Bread loses quite a bit of water weight as it bakes,” Barb explains. “Moisture loss can vary from one type of bread to the next, but expect at least 15% weight reduction for most breads.”If you ever take an artisan bread class at Baking School, you’ll learn that when crusty loaves of bread (think baguettes or boules) are pulled out of the oven, they should have extremely firm crusts that only yield when squeezed very hard. Use your senses: SightCrust color is a clear visual indicator of bread doneness, but Barb says different types of bread have varying levels of color to look for.Sandwich bread and pan loaves: “The color should be a rich golden brown and the top crust should feel firm. Don’t be afraid to tilt the loaf out of the pan to be sure the sides and bottom are also nicely golden brown and sturdy.”Challah or other free-form enriched loaves : “Look for the lightest part of the loaf (between the braids or an area that isn’t egg-washed) to have taken on some color. It won’t be as dark as the egg-washed surface, but it shouldn’t look too pale or doughy either. Look for a lighter golden brown in these areas. Check the bottom of the loaf for color and firmness as well.”Brioche : “This one can be tricky because you really need to bake to a rich brown color for the interior to be fully baked, since the butter and sugar causes brioche to brown more quickly. Take your bread out when the crust is a deep mahogany and don’t be afraid! Color means flavor.”Crusty artisan loaves and sourdough : “Dark color translates to more flavor, so I go a bit darker with these types of breads. Our Baking Ambassador Martin Philip shares helpful intel in a great article on this subject,” Barb recommends. One takeaway: Look for a little strip of char on the loaf’s ear, like it’s wearing eyeliner. And just because your bread is finished baking, that doesn’t mean it’s doneIt’s important to remove your bread from the oven at the correct time, and it’s handy to have your thermometer to check the internal temperature, but that’s not all it takes to nail the perfect bake.“Remember that bread isn’t fully done when it comes out of the oven,” advises Barb. “Moisture continues to be released as bread cools, and the internal structure of the loaf needs that time to set completely. Unless you want to end up with a gummy interior, let your bread cool completely before slicing into it.” (Moist, dense rye breads with a high percentage of rye flour often benefit from up to 24 hours of cooling time!)In the end, the best way to develop your baking sixth sense is to keep practicing, paying attention to these cues each time. “I know trusting your senses can seem difficult at first,” says Barb, “but this is one of those baking skills that will improve with every loaf you bake!”

1) Weigh, don’t scoop, your flourA little too much flour can be the difference between a dry, cakey cookie and a fudgy, chewy one. And if you’re weighing your flour by volume (i.e., with measuring cups), then it’s very likely you’re adding too much flour.That’s because measuring flour by volume is wildly inconsistent: It all depends on how densely the flour is packed into the cup. If the flour is more condensed, a cup can hold up to 160g of flour. If you fluff and scoop, as we recommend, a cup will hold around 120g.Don’t have a scale? Buy one now! In the meantime, here’s how to measure flour correctly by volume.But if you weigh your flour with a scale? You’ll always get exactly 120g of flour per cup, precisely as our Test Kitchen (or whoever developed your recipe) intends. Which translates to cookies with the perfect texture, whether that’s chewy chocolate chip cookies or crumbly, buttery shortbread.2) Ensure your butter is the right temperatureHere’s a common ingredient line in cookie recipes: 8 tablespoons (113g) unsalted butter, at room temperature.Don’t ignore those last three words! Butter needs to be the correct temperature to cream with sugar (more on that below), which means it should be right in the Goldilocks zone — not too hot and soft, and not too cold and hard.But what exactly does room temperature mean? You should be able to press an indent into the butter with one finger, as if you were pressing it into clay. The butter should not be so warm that it’s greasy; it should still be slightly cool, with a bit of resistance when you press it. The best way to get your butter to room temperature is to leave it out on the counter for a few hours. But if you need to get butter to room temperature quickly? We tested tons of different methods to determine the best one. This is what creamed butter and sugar should look like.3) Cream correctlyTypically, one of the first steps when making cookie dough is to cream butter and sugar together. This process aerates the mixture — the hard sugar crystals cut through the room-temperature butter, creating tiny pockets of air that help leaven the cookie when it bakes. If you don’t cream butter and sugar long enough, it will still be gritty and dense, which may result in grainy cookies that don’t puff or spread. Meanwhile, if you cream butter and sugar for too long, it will introduce too much air, causing your cookies to potentially puff excessively and become cakey while baking. Properly creaming should take about four minutes on medium speed in a stand mixer, until the mixture is pale and fluffy.4) Don’t substitute granulated sugar for brown sugarSugar is sugar, right? Nope! Brown sugar is white granulated sugar with molasses added back in — up to 10% molasses, by weight. This translates to several key differences in your cookie baking. Besides adding caramelized flavor and golden color to cookies, brown sugar is acidic and lowers pH — which is important to activate baking soda, a leavener typically called for in recipes that use brown sugar. (Low pH brown sugar + high pH baking soda = the reaction of leavening.) Using granulated sugar instead would require tinkering with acid levels and leaveners to achieve the same reaction. What’s more, if you use white sugar in place of brown, your cookies may spread less (or more, depending on the other ingredients in the recipe).5) Don’t skip (or shorten!) the chillChilling cookie dough can be annoying — do you really want to wait longer for freshly baked cookies? But as tempted as you may be to skip this step, don’t. It’s crucial for many reasons: Chilling cookie dough controls spread, concentrates flavor, and creates cookies with chewy/crisp (rather than soft/doughy) texture. Skipping or shortening that chill may result in thin cookies with less browning and blander flavor. So wait the extra 30 minutes — it’s worth it.Use a cookie scoop to portion dough with ease (and bake on a nonstick cookie mat to control spreading).6) Make scooping seamlessFor a uniform appearance and an even, circular shape in all your cookies, use a cookie scoop to portion out the dough. You can choose your preferred size — small, medium, or large — then scoop and drop in half the time it takes to do so with a spoon.And a bonus tip: If your cookies still turn out a little wonky, you can use a drinking glass to transform them into perfect circles. When the baked cookies are just out of the oven and still hot, take a wide-mouthed drinking glass and turn it over to cover the cookie. Move the glass in a circle, rounding the cookie’s edges as you do so to smooth it into an even shape.7) Line your pan the right wayIt matters how you line your pan, and we’ve done the baking to prove it. In an experiment testing five different pan lining methods against each other, cookbook author Jesse Szewczyk found that cookie spread varied wildly depending on how the pan was lined. A greased baking sheet caused unsightly dark bottoms and burned edges, while an ungreased, unlined baking sheet put cookies at the risk of sticking. Baking on aluminum foil caused the cookies to spread extensively and become thin and crispy.When lining your pan to bake cookies, we recommend two methods. A good, safe bet is to use parchment paper. The cookies spread just enough while maintaining a nicely domed center. For even more consistent results, baking on a nonstick mat resulted in perfectly shaped cookies that spread just the right amount. Leave at least several inches between scoops of cookie dough.8) Give your cookies spaceCookies tend to spread more than you think they will. So as much as you may want to knock out an entire batch of dough at once, resist the urge to crowd them on the baking sheet. Instead, leave several inches in between each ball of dough. Otherwise, the cookies can spread and run into each other, transforming them into messy shapes and ruining the contrast between crispy edges and chewy centers.And for extra insurance, follow the next tip, then space cookies based on what you learn there …9) Bake a batch of test cookiesBefore placing all your dough in the oven and hoping for the best, bake one or two test cookies before scooping and baking the entire batch. That way you can do a complete initial assessment of:1. How much do the cookies spread (or not spread)?2. What size are they (too big, too small, just right)?3. How do they taste (do they need a bit more salt, or cinnamon)?4. What’s their texture (crispy, crunchy, chewy, soft)?5. Does the given baking time work for your oven (were they burned, or underdone)?6. Does it matter if you cool the cookies on a pan vs. on a rack?Adjust accordingly before baking the full batch to guarantee your best bake. For a soft — not snappy — interior, make sure you pull your cookies from the oven at the correct time.10) Don’t overbakeIt’s always best to err on the side of underbaking a cookie, instead of overbaking. Typically, cookies should still look a little underdone when you pull them from the oven — that’s because they’ll continue to bake on the hot baking sheet, and they’ll settle and firm up as they cool. You want to remove your cookies from the oven once they’re just set in the middle, with golden brown edges. If you’re unsure what “set” looks like, keep an eye on their shine. If the dough is shiny as it bakes (thanks to the butter or other fat in it), that shine will significantly reduce or go away once the cookies are set. As soon as they reach that stage, remove them from the oven. Even if they don’t feel firm yet, they’ll continue to set and harden as they cool.Ready to bake your best cookies yet? What is yeast, and how is it made?Yeast is a single-cell organism, part of the fungi kingdom. The yeast we use most often today, Saccharomyces cerevisiae, is one of the oldest domesticated organisms known to mankind: It’s been helping humans bake bread and brew alcohol for thousands of years. Fittingly, the Latin translation of Saccharomyces cerevisiae is “sweet fungi of beer.”Saccharomyces cerevisiae is just one strain of the more than 1,500 identified species of yeast. But wait, there’s more — literally. Those 1,500 identified yeasts are just an estimated 1% of the yeast population in the world; most species remain as yet unnamed.In order to have a reliable supply of yeast on hand for all of our baking needs, it’s necessary for manufacturers to “domesticate” wild yeast — stabilizing it, and in the process making it 200 times stronger than its wild counterpart.Plant scientists working with a yeast manufacturer identify certain characteristics of wild yeast that they decide are desirable, isolate them, and then replicate them. The resulting yeast is given a “training” diet (such as molasses or corn syrup) to make it reproduce and grow. Once the cells have replicated to a critical mass — a process that generally takes about a week — they’re filtered, dried, packaged, and sent off to the market.What does yeast do?Yeast makes bread rise. Just as baking soda and baking powder make your muffins and cakes rise, yeast makes breads of all kinds rise — sandwich loaves, rolls, pizza crust, artisan hearth breads, and more. If you’re baking with yeast, here’s how to tell if your bread dough has risen enough.How does yeast work?Since yeast doesn’t reproduce without a good supply of oxygen, it stops reproducing once it’s in dough. Instead, it starts to eat: Sugar (sucrose and fructose) is its favorite food. If there is sugar in the dough, that’s what the yeast eats first; once that’s gone, enzymes convert the starch in flour into sugars for the yeast to consume; thus flour is capable of providing yeast with a continuous food source.The byproducts of feeding yeast are carbon dioxide, alcohol, and organic acids. Carbon dioxide released by yeast is trapped in bread dough’s elastic web of gluten; think of blowing up a balloon. Alcohol and organic acids disperse throughout the dough, enhancing baked bread’s flavor. As long as moisture and food are available, yeast will continue to eat and produce carbon dioxide, alcohol, and organic acids. If your bread stops rising, it’s usually not because the yeast isn’t working (or has died); it’s because the yeast has run out of food or the gluten has somehow become “leaky” and begun to deteriorate, failing to retain carbon dioxide.What factors affect how well yeast works?If you’ve ever baked bread, you’ve probably noticed that sometimes yeast seems to work more quickly than other times. Yeast, like any living organism, is happiest when it’s in a comfortable environment. For yeast, this means plenty of food and moisture; the right pH (acid balance); and the right amount of warmth. Yeast prefers temperatures between 70°F and 100°F; for convenience’s sake, and to produce the most flavorful loaf, it’s best to keep rising conditions on the cooler end of that range, rather than warmer, which can cause the dough to rise too quickly, before it’s had a chance to develop its full flavor.Salt and sugar can both slow down yeast activity. Each of them is osmotic, meaning they can pull moisture out of yeast cells, thus adversely affecting how the yeast functions. We add salt to yeast dough both for flavor, and to moderate yeast’s work; we don’t want our loaves rising too fast. (See more here: Why is salt important in yeast bread?) Sugar is optional; a little bit makes yeast happy, but too much — generally, more than 1/4 cup per 3 cups of flour — slows yeast down. Cinnamon is also a yeast inhibitor — you can’t use more than 1 teaspoon per 3 cups of flour in a dough without it slowing down the rise significantly.My yeast didn’t work! Now what?There are all kinds of reasons why bread fails to rise; weak or dead yeast is one of them. Though you may have just purchased your yeast, it may not have been stored or rotated correctly prior to your purchasing it so that it isn’t, in fact, as new as you think it is. A vacuum-sealed bag of yeast stored at room temperature will remain fresh indefinitely. Once the seal is broken, it should go into the freezer for optimum shelf life. (See “What’s the best way to store yeast?” below.)A vacuum-sealed bag of yeast stored at high temperatures, however — e.g., in a hot kitchen over the summer, or in a hot warehouse before delivery — will lose its effectiveness fairly quickly. After a while, if stored improperly, yeast cells will die. And if you use dead (or dying) yeast in your bread, it won’t rise.To make sure your yeast is active before you start mixing, see our blog post: How to test yeast for freshness. Another reason yeast might not work: You may have killed it by using overly hot water in your recipe; water hotter than 139°F will kill yeast. But don’t stress too much about temperature; 139°F is way hotter than is comfortable to the touch. If you stepped into a bathtub of 139°F water, you’d leap out fast. So long as the water you combine with your yeast feels comfortable to you, it’ll be comfortable for the yeast, too. How much is a “packet” of yeast?You may find older recipes calling for “1 packet active dry yeast.” A packet used to include 1 tablespoon of yeast; currently, it’s closer to 2 1/4 teaspoons, since improved manufacturing methods now produce stronger, more active yeast.Can I vary the amount of yeast in a recipe to quicken or slow down how my dough rises?The amount of yeast you use in your bread dough has a significant bearing on how quickly it’ll rise. By reducing the yeast, you ensure a long, slow rise, one more likely to produce a strong dough able to withstand the rigors of baking. The more yeast in a recipe initially, the quicker it produces carbon dioxide, alcohol, and organic acids. Alcohol, being acidic, weakens the gluten in the dough, and eventually, the dough becomes “porous” and won’t rise, or won’t rise very well.By starting with a smaller amount of yeast, you slow down the amount of carbon dioxide, alcohol, and organic acids being released into the dough, thus ensuring the gluten remains strong and the bread rises well — from its initial rise in the bowl to its final rise in the oven. Remember that this slow rise extends to the shaped loaf, as well as the dough in the bowl. Once you’ve shaped your loaf, covered it, and set it aside to rise again, it may take 2 hours or more, rather than the usual 1 to 1 1/2, to rise fully and be ready for the oven.Here are some guidelines to get you started. If you’re an occasional bread baker, cut back the usual 2 to 2 1/4 teaspoons of instant yeast to 1/2 to 1 teaspoon, depending on how long you want to let the dough ferment before the final shape-rise-bake process. 1/2 teaspoon would give you lots of flexibility, such as letting the dough “rest” for 16 to 20 hours; 1 teaspoon would be a good amount for an all-day or overnight rise (10 hours or so, at cool room temperature). If you’re using active dry yeast, which isn’t as vigorous as instant yeast, we’d up the range to 3/4 to 1 1/2 teaspoons.I’ve heard that when you’re doubling a recipe, you shouldn’t double the yeast, too. Is that true?You can increase the size of most bread recipes by simply doubling, tripling, etc. all of the ingredients, including the yeast. Depending on the recipe and rising time, you may use as little as 1 teaspoon, or up to 2 1/4 teaspoons (sometimes more) of instant yeast per pound (about 4 cups) of flour.That being said, many home recipes, particularly older ones, use more yeast than this; so when you double or triple the yeast, you may find that your dough is rising too fast — faster than you can comfortably deal with it. In addition, if you’ve increased your recipe by five times or more, and also increased the yeast by five times, keep in mind the time it will take you to shape the dough. You may find the rising dough outpaces your ability to get it shaped and baked. If that’s the case, make a note to reduce the amount of yeast next time. What’s the difference between active dry yeast and instant yeast?In days gone by there was a significant difference between active dry yeast and instant yeast. Today, the difference is minimal, and the two can be used interchangeably — with slightly different results. Let’s look at active dry yeast first.Active dry yeastOriginally, the classic active dry yeast manufacturing process dried live yeast cells quickly, at a high temperature. The result? Only about 30% of the cells survived. Dead cells “cocooned” around the live ones, making it necessary to “proof” the yeast — dissolve it in warm water — before using.These days, active dry yeast is manufactured using a much gentler process, resulting in many more live cells. Thus, it’s no longer necessary to dissolve active dry yeast in warm water before using — feel free to mix it with the dry ingredients, just as you do instant yeast.Active dry yeast, compared to instant yeast, is considered more “moderate.” It gets going more slowly, but eventually catches up to instant — think of the tortoise and the hare. Many bread-bakers appreciate the longer rise times active dry yeast encourages; it’s during fermentation of its dough that bread develops flavor.Fleischmann’s and Red Star are the two brands of active dry yeasts you’re most likely to see in your supermarket.Instant yeastThis yeast is manufactured to a smaller granule size than active dry. Thus, with more surface area exposed to the liquid in a recipe, it dissolves more quickly, and gets going faster than active dry. While you can proof it if you like, it’s not necessary; like active dry yeast, simply mixing it into your bread dough along with the rest of the dry ingredients works just fine.One caveat: In dough that’s high in sugar (generally, more than 1/4 cup sugar per 3 cups of flour), the sugar evens things out, and instant yeast and active dry yeast will perform the same. (For very sweet breads, you might want to consider using SAF Gold Instant Yeast; for more on that, read below.)Can I use active dry and instant yeasts interchangeably?Yes, they can be substituted for one another 1:1. We’ve found that active dry yeast is a little bit slower off the mark than instant, as far as dough rising goes; but in a long (2- to 3-hour) rise, the active dry yeast catches up. If a recipe using instant yeast calls for the dough to “double in size, about 1 hour,” you may want to mentally add 15 to 20 minutes to this time if you’re using active dry yeast.When dough is rising, you need to judge it by how much it’s risen, not how long it takes; cold weather, low barometric pressure, and a host of other factors affect dough rising times, so use them as a guide, not an unbreakable rule.One time when you might not want to use instant and active dry yeasts interchangeably is when you’re baking bread in a bread machine. Since bread machines use a higher temperature to raise dough, substituting instant for active dry yeast 1:1 may cause bread to over-rise, then collapse. When baking in the bread machine and substituting instant yeast for active dry, reduce the amount of instant yeast by 25%.RapidRise, instant, bread machine yeast … is there truly any difference?Bread machine yeast and instant yeast are the same yeast. RapidRise, Fleischmann’s branded instant yeast, is also an instant yeast, but a different strain than SAF or Red Star.We find RapidRise is faster out of the gate than SAF or Red Star, but it gives out sooner. And since we like to give our loaves leisurely rises (a long rise brings out bread’s flavor), we like SAF or Red Star. What’s gold yeast?SAF Gold Instant Yeast, another SAF variety, is an “osmotolerant” yeast, perfect for sweet breads and any dough with a high amount of sugar. SAF Gold works best when the amount of sugar is between 10% and 30% of the amount of the flour, by weight (this is called a “baker’s percentage”). So, for a 3-cup-flour loaf (360g flour), you’d choose SAF Gold if the sugar is greater than 3 tablespoons, or up to about a heaping 1/2 cup. Understand that the greater the amount of sugar, the more slowly your dough will rise.How does SAF Gold work? Sugar likes to absorb water; and when there is sugar in bread dough, it pulls water away from yeast, leaving the yeast thirsty. The yeast cells in SAF Gold are bred to require less liquid to function, so they’re better able to withstand sugar’s greedy ways with water.SAF Gold is best used in sweet breads; for “lean” doughs (low in sugar and fat), SAF generally recommends red-label yeast.What’s fresh yeast?Originally, fresh yeast was the only yeast option, until dried yeast arrived on the market in the 1940s. It comes in a moist, firm block with the consistency of clay. Fresh yeast lends a slightly sweeter, richer flavor to baked goods compared to dry yeast. One downside, though, is its short shelf life: Unlike dry yeast, it’s highly perishable and must be stored in the refrigerator. Even then, it usually only lasts about a week or two — opened or unopened.Despite these differences, both fresh and dry yeast perform the same function in baking, and fresh yeast will make your bread rise just like dry yeast. For more info on fresh yeast and how to convert between fresh and dry yeast, see our previous post: How do I bake with fresh yeast?What’s the best way to store yeast?We recommend transferring dry yeast (not fresh) to an airtight container (glass or acrylic) and storing it in the freezer for up to a year. If you buy yeast in bulk (e.g., a 1-pound vacuum-packed brick), open it up; divide it into three or four smaller portions, and store each in a tightly closed container. A zip-top freezer bag works well.When you’re ready to use yeast, remove the bag or jar from the freezer, spoon out what you need, and quickly return it to the freezer. Yeast manufacturers say you should let frozen yeast rest at room temperature for 30 to 45 minutes before using; frankly, we’re usually too impatient to do that, and have never experienced any problem using yeast straight from the freezer.

For many new bakers and a few veterans, too, cakes are some of the first baked goods we make on our own. We may start with a mix, but then when we realize how easy a cake can be, we branch out to from-scratch cakes and encounter a deceptively simple direction right off the bat: “Cream the softened butter and sugar until light and fluffy.”Why we cream butter and sugarIn creaming the butter and sugar together, you are using the sugar to aerate the butter and fill it with bubbles that can capture the gasses released by your leavener (usually baking soda and/or baking powder). The more fine bubbles you have in your network, the lighter in texture your cakes will be and the finer the crumb. This is true for your muffins as well, while it makes your cookies light and crisp instead of hard and dense.How to cream butter and sugar the right wayJust like Goldilocks, we can encounter a variety of issues when dealing with this phrase. Too hard, too soft, and just right. Just what does softened butter look like? Should it be melted? How long do you beat? Should I set my mixer to low or high? How do I know when it’s right?What your butter should look like before creaming Not too hard, not too soft — just right.Your butter should be at room temperature before creaming. But what exactly does that mean? You should be able to press an indent into the butter with one finger, as if you were pressing it into clay. The butter should not be so warm that it’s greasy; it should still be slightly cool, with a bit of resistance when you press it.The best way to get your butter to room temperature is to leave it out on the counter for a few hours. But if you need to get butter to room temperature quickly? We tested tons of different methods to determine the best one.Creaming butter and sugar: How temperature makes a differenceNext, let’s explore what will happen if you cream your sugar with butter that’s too cold, too warm, and just right. Up first, butter that’s too cold.If your butter is too cold and hardAgain, the main reason you want to cream butter and sugar is to use the sugar crystals to punch little holes in the butter and have those holes capture air. Butter that is too cold won’t expand very easily, and it’ll never capture much air. The result? Heavy and dense, the creamed butter will resemble a chunky, grainy spread that’s the consistency of natural peanut butter. There’s also little or no change in color. Properly creamed butter and sugar will be pale yellow in color, but not white (more on this later). Sugar creamed with cold butter is chunky and dense.If your butter is too warm and softIf the butter is too soft or melted, the air bubbles will be created but then will collapse again. This causes a greasy, wet mixture that will result in heavy, soggy cakes. Any air bubbles you’ve managed to create will also be knocked out as soon as the eggs and flour are added. (As a side note, this is also what happens if you try to cream oil and sugar. Leave the oil for recipes that don’t call for the creaming method.) Sugar creamed with warm or melted butter is grainy and greasy.If your butter is just rightNow that we’ve seen both extremes, let’s check out the results when the butter is at the right temperature. The mixture is lightened in color, it’s visibly fluffy, and it’s not clinging to the sides of the bowl. Sugar creamed with room temperature butter is pale and fluffy.Let’s look at the three results side by side. Starting on the left: too cold and the mixture sits in a lump. Too warm, and the mixture spreads out and has an oily layer. Finally, properly creamed, the mixture sits up tall and has visible fluffy peaks. From left to right: sugar creamed with cold butter, warm butter, and room temperature butter.Besides looks, the feel of each mixture will be different as well. Under-creamed and your mix will feel like wet sand or damp cornmeal. Over-creamed, and your mix will have the feel of oil and sugar on your fingers, rather like a facial scrub. Your well-creamed mix will be moist and light and the sugar will be nearly dissolved. You’ll barely feel any grit when you rub it between your fingers.The right mixing speed and duration for creamingOf course, having correctly softened butter is just one part of the equation, albeit a big one. Mixing at too high or too low a speed and for too short or long a time will also wreak havoc with your creaming. With the advent of the more powerful stand mixers that we use today, gone are the days of having to whip the butter and sugar mixture on high speed for several minutes to achieve good results. Instead, a moderate speed (typically speed 3 to 4 on a stand mixer) for 2 to 3 minutes is sufficient to get the aeration you’re looking for, being sure to scrape the bowl halfway through.Under-creamed butter and sugarIf you under-cream your butter and sugar mixture, it will remain dense, grainy, and dark in color: Under-creamed butter and sugarIf you under-cream your butter and sugar mixture, it will remain dense, grainy, and dark in color.Correctly creamed butter and sugarPerfectly creamed butter and sugar should be light, fluffy, and pale in color (but not white). Perfectly creamed butter and sugarPerfectly creamed butter and sugar should be light, fluffy, and pale in color (but not white).Over-creamed butter and sugarIf you beat too long and hard, the mixture will be over-creamed, becoming nearly white in color. Because it’s too aerated, it can result in dense, gummy streaks in your cake when baking. Over-creamed butter and sugar.Unfortunately, if the butter and sugar has gone this far there’s no going back.
